Genetic factors, particularly those concerning HLA class II, have been associated with the pathogenesis of pemphigus. Taking advantage of an area where pemphigus foliaceus (PF) and pemphigus vulgaris (PV) are prevalent in the northeastern region of the state of São Paulo, Southeastern Brazil, we have studied the HLA class I (A, B and C) and class II (DRB1 and DQA1/DQB1) profiles in 86 and 83 patients with PF and PV, respectively, as compared with 1592 controls from the same region. Among all the HLA alleles described herein, the more prevalent susceptibility alleles for PF were HLA-A*11, 33, -B*14; -DRB1*01:01, *01:02; -DQA1*01:02; and -DQB1*05:01. In PV patients, the HLA-B*38; -C*12; -DRB1*04:02, *08:04, *14:01, *14:04; -DQA1*03:01; and -DQB1*03:02 and *05:03 alleles were associated with susceptibility. The HLA-DRB1*01:02 allele and the HLA-DRB1*01-DQA1*01-DQB1*05 haplotype in PF patients and the HLA-DRB1*04:02 and *14:01 alleles and the HLA-DRB1*14-DQA1*01-DQB1*05 haplotype in PV patients were related with the highest etiologic fraction values. Distinct genetic patterns and not yet described HLA susceptibility/protection alleles/haplotypes profiles have been observed in this series. Our findings corroborate the differential genetic markers in PF and PV in an area where pemphigus is prevalent but not yet reported.

Hantavirus cardiopulmonary syndrome is a severe human disease associated with hantavirus infection. The clinical course of illness varies greatly among individuals, possibly due to viral and immunological elements and the influence of host genetic factors on clinical outcome. As the magnitude of immune activation has been associated with disease severity, polymorphisms in genes involved in the immune response that may affect the development of this syndrome were investigated. Polymorphisms in the TGF-ß, IL-10, IL-6, and IFN-γ genes, human leukocyte antigens (HLA), and human platelet alloantigens (HPA) genes were investigated in 122 patients with Araraquara virus infection from Ribeirão Preto, Brazil. Patients were divided into two groups: hantavirus cardiopulmonary syndrome (HCPS group; n = 26) and hantavirus seropositive only (n = 96). The frequencies of HLA alleles, cytokines and platelet antigen genotypes were evaluated in both groups and compared to a control group. The data demonstrated no significant influence of the HLA alleles, HPA, IL-6, and IL-10 genotypes on susceptibility to hantavirus infection. However, the hantavirus seropositive group presented a significantly higher frequency of a polymorphism associated with a high IFN-γ production than the HCPS group. In addition, a genotype associated with high TGF-ß production was found more frequently in individuals infected with hantavirus than in the control group. This phenotype was associated with a less intense thrombocytopenia in the HCPS group and may be protective against the most severe form of hantavirus disease. More studies are required to quantify further the influence of the high TGF-ß producer phenotype on the outcome of hantavirus infection.

Activation of the immune response in hantavirus cardiopulmonary syndrome (HCPS) leads to a high TNF production, probably contributing to the disease. The polymorphic TNF2 allele (TNF -308G/A) has been associated with increased cytokine production. We investigated the association of the TNF2 allele with the outcome of hantavirus infection in Brazilian patients. A total of 122 hantavirus-exposed individuals (26 presenting HCPS and 96 only hantavirus seroconversion) were studied. The TNF2 allele was more frequently found in HCPS patients than in individuals with positive serology for hantavirus but without a history of HCPS illness, suggesting that the TNF2 allele could represent a risk factor for developing HCPS.

Cytomegalovirus retinochoroiditis (CMV-R) is the primary cause of blindness among AIDS patients. Since HLA-G is associated with the modulation of the immune response, we hypothesized that variability at the 3' untraslated region (3'UTR) of the gene could be implicated on the predisposition to CMV-R. We evaluated whether HLA-G 3'UTR influences CMV-R development in Brazilian AIDS patients. Peripheral blood DNA was obtained from two groups of patients: (1) AIDS exhibiting CMV-R (n = 40) and (2) AIDS without CMV-R (n = 147). HLA-G 3'UTR typing was performed using sequencing analysis. Allele, genotype and haplotype frequencies were evaluated using Fisher's exact test accompanied by the calculation of the odds ratio and its 95% confidence interval (95% CI). The etiologic (EF) and preventive fractions were also estimated. Compared to AIDS patients without CMV-R, AIDS patients with CMV-R showed increased frequencies of the: (1) + 3001T allele, (2) the + 3001C/T genotype and (3) the UTR-17 (InsTTCCGTGACG) haplotype (EFs = 0.02-0.04). The UTR-3 (DelTCCGCGACG) haplotype was associated with protection against CMV-R development. Although the risk for developing CMR-V at the population level was relatively low (EF), the identification of HLA-G 3'UTR variation sites may help to further evaluate the role of post-transcriptional factors that may contribute to the existent immunosuppresion caused by HIV per se.

Rare are the family studies that include siblings affected by pemphigus vulgaris (PV) and in whom HLA class II alleles are related. HLA-DR and -DQ genotyping and profiling of antibodies against desmogleins (Dsg) 1 and Dsg3 were performed in ten members of a family including monozygotic twins affected by PV. The twin sisters were heterozygotes; they presented the haplotypes most commonly associated with increased susceptibility to PV (DRB1∗04:02-DQA1∗03:01-DQB1∗03:02 and DRB1∗14:04-DQA1∗01:01-DQB1∗05:03). Their parents and five siblings had only one or none of these two haplotypes in combination with the alleles or haplotypes associated with resistance to PV (DRB1∗07:01-DQA1∗02:01-DQB1∗02:02 and DRB1∗13:01-DQA1∗01:03-DQB1∗06:03). Only the monozygotic twins presented IgG antibodies against both Dsg1 and Dsg3. According to our knowledge based on a review of published literature on the topic, this is the first report of PV affecting monozygotic twins.

Besides the well recognized association of HLA-DRB1 and DQB1 alleles with type 1 diabetes mellitus (T1D), linkage studies have identified a gene region close to the non-classical class I HLA-G gene as an independent susceptibility marker. HLA-G is constitutively expressed in the endocrine compartment of the human pancreas and may play a role in controlling autoimmune responses. We evaluated the genetic diversity of the 3' untranslated region (3'UTR) of HLA-G, which have been associated with HLA-G mRNA post-transcriptional regulation, in 120 Brazilian T1D patients and in 120 healthy controls. We found the +3001 T allele was observed only in T1D patients. Notably, the +3001 T allele was in linkage disequilibrium with polymorphic sites associated with low production of HLA-G mRNA or soluble HLA-G levels. Moreover, T1D patients showed a low frequency of the HLA-G 3'UTR-17 (14bpINS/+3001T/+3003T/+3010C/+3027C/+3035T/+3142G/+3187A/+3196C). The +3010 CC genotype and the UTR-3 haplotype (14bpDEL/+3001C/+3003T/+3010C/+3027C/+3035C/+3142G/+3187A/+3196C), associated with low and moderate soluble HLA-G expression, respectively, were underrepresented in patients. The decreased expression of HLA-G at the pancreas level should be detrimental in individuals genetically prone to produce less HLA-G.

PURPOSE: To evaluate the human leucocyte antigen (HLA) class 1 (HLA-A and HLA-B) and HLA class 2 (HLA-DRB1 and HLA-DQB1) allele profiles in the susceptibility to cytomegalovirus retinitis (CMV-R) in patients with AIDS. METHODS: Cytomegalovirus retinitis was clinically diagnosed by indirect binocular ophthalmoscopy. Human leucocyte antigens class 1 were typed using a complement-dependent microlymphocytotoxicity assay, and HLA class 2 alleles were identified using amplified DNA hybridized to sequence-specific oligonucleotide primers. RESULTS: The frequencies of HLA class 1 antigens and HLA class 2 alleles observed in patients and controls were similar; however, HLA-A31 antigen was over-represented in patients with AIDS, independent of the presence of CMV-R. CONCLUSION: There was no association between HLA molecules/alleles and CMV-R in Brazilian patients with AIDS. However, the results support the role of the HLA system in the susceptibility to developing AIDS.
